Media & Capital Partners welcomes new Director

Media & Capital Partners has brought in Russell Quinn as Director, where he will be leading the Perth office. He has wrapped up seven years at Sodali & Co.

Russell has held senior roles at the NDIS as well as within the government and banking sectors including Bankwest and CBA, following his career in journalism at News Corp and Seven.

Regional comms promotion at Louis Vuitton

Cathy Chia has been elevated to Regional Senior Communications Manager at Louis Vuitton.

Based in Singapore, she leads strategic communications, events, social media and thought leadership initiatives across the Southeast Asia and Oceania region. Cathy has accumulated more than 13 years of communications experience across the hospitality and retail sectors.

UNOPS strengthens global engagement with new comms officer

April Sirait has joined UNOPS as a Communications Officer, supporting strategic communications and global stakeholder engagement for the Forest and Climate Leaders’ Partnership.

Drawing on experience across media, environment and international development, she previously worked at CNN Indonesia TV, EcoNusa Foundation, and Nutrition International.

DARKHORSE grows its team and client portfolio

Brand experience and communications agency, DARKHORSE, has welcomed new appointments to its teams in Australia, New Zealand, and Singapore, alongside a new addition to its client portfolio. 

Maxine Reed (left) has joined the agency in Sydney as Experiential Director. She previously spent four years at Havas Red, where she led the Brand Experience team for clients including Lexus, Toyota, L'Oréal, Netflix, Tourism Tasmania, and AppleTV+. Prior to that, she spent five years in events and marketing roles at Amazon.

Auckland-based Olivia Muir (right) has also started as Experiential Director. The move follows three years at Mango Communications (now FleishmanHillard), where she worked on client accounts including McDonald's and New Balance. Prior to that, she worked on sponsorship and brand experience at Spark.

Rounding out the appointments, Elizabeth O’Leary (middle) has joined the DARKHORSE team in Singapore as Creative Director.

DARKHORSE has also been appointed to lead Veuve Clicquot's Clicquot Sun Lodge, following a competitive pitch.

Founder and CEO of DARKHORSE, Mike Hewitt, said: "DARKHORSE has become the brand experience agency iconic brands continue to choose across APAC. Our new partnership with Veuve Clicquot, and the appointments of Maxine, Olivia, and Elizabeth are all moments to celebrate. We’ve seen fantastic growth throughout the region and our team is set to continue the great work we’ve built a reputation on delivering.”
